NEWSical The Musical and Christine Pedi have brought together some of her best loved celebrity impressions to take you inside the audition room for the highly anticipated Broadway revival of Hello Dolly starring Bette Midler. Check it out below!

NEWsical the Musical, the 2011 winner of the Off-Broadway Alliance Award, recently celebrated its 2000th performance at Theatre Row. Now in its 5th smash year, NEWSical is New York's ever-evolving musical mockery of all the news that's fit to spoof.

Christine Pedi is a Drama Desk nominee who can be heard daily on Sirius XM's On Broadway. She made her Broadway debut in Little Me, was featured in Talk Radio, and was most recently seen in Chicago as Mama Morton. For the past 5 years she has appeared in NEWSical the Musical, has been seen in several Forbidden Broadways, and numerous cabaret and nightlife appearances.

NEWSical is proudly produced by Tom D'Angora and was created by and written by Rick Crom (Urinetown) with direction by Mark Waldrop (When Pigs Fly, My Deah, Papermill Playhouse's Gypsy) and music direction by Ed Goldschneider, and is currently stage managed by Krystal Roccaro. It was named Best New Musical of 2011 by the Off Broadway Alliance.
